#1e5042 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e5042 is composed of 11.8% red, 31.4%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.5%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 163.2 degrees, a saturation of 45.5% and a lightness of 21.6%. #1e5042 color hex could be obtained by blending #3ca084 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#1e5042
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030907 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fc is the lightest one.
